Couch to 5k.....come join me!!

Ok, I tried this once before and got way to eager. I started moving quicker than designed. This time I will follow the guidelines.

If you are not familiar with a Couch to 5K, it is a plan to go from not running at all to running 5k (3.2 miles) in only 2 months. It is very doable and such a great feeling of accomplishment. I ran/walked a 5k in May and it was one of the most rewarding things I have done in many years.

Here is the link to the info.. If anyone is interested in training together just join in.

Cool Running :: The Couch-to-5K Running Plan

We will start on Monday, June 29.

Anne... welcome! Your speed if good, don't worry about it. I've been running since the summer, started out at about 4.3 mph, and now I'm up to about 4.7 - 5.0 max. My only advice... follow the c25k schedule (there are podcasts available) for the first 5 weeks or so. Pick your pace and advance to the next week when you feel ready. I repeated weeks. Most important... commit to it and have FUN!

Kathy~I got the yaktraks. I think that is how it is spelled, they are like chains for your shoes. I got the pro version that has a strap over the top of your shoe so they would stay on while I was running.

I had really good traction. No slipping and I was able to push off really easily.

Anna... I wish there was one with current music instead of what's offered. If you're running on a treadmill and can keep track of time, then I'd suggest you just create your own mix of songs. If you're running outside, then it becomes more difficult to know when to walk and when to run. That's why I used the podcasts until about week 8 (3rd try of week 5). Once I was just running without the walk intervals, I started using my own music. Much more motivating.
